算法交易的交易策略

2024-05-06 10:43

1. 算法交易的交易策略

为了满足不同的交易策略需求,很多不同的算法层出不穷。这些算法技巧通常都会被冠以一个名字,例如“冰山一角Iceberging”、 “游击队员Guerrilla”, “基准点Benchmarking”, “狙击手Sniper” 和 “嗅探器Sniffer”。 “基准点”算法被交易员用来模拟指数收益,而“嗅探器”算法被用来发现最动荡或最不稳定的市场。任何类型的模式识别或者预测模型都能用来启动算法交易。神经网络和基因编程也已经被用来创造算法模型。麻省理工学院金融工程实验室主任Andrew Lo表示,“现在算法交易开始成为一场军备竞赛,每个人都在设计更复杂的算法,而且竞争越多,利润空间越小。”

算法交易的交易策略

2. 算法交易的问题进展

更复杂的模型和智能程序已经引出了模型会否失效的问题。有人批评算法交易系统的“黑匣子”特性:“交易员有世界如何运转的直觉。但是对这些系统你输入一串数字,然后从另一端出来一些结果,而黑匣子为什么会产生这些数据或关系,确并不那么直观或清晰。”英国的金融服务管理局(Financial Services Authority, FSA)一直在关注着算法交易的发展。在该机构年报上,监管层强调这项新科技给市场带来的巨大功效,但同时也指出,对复杂的技术和模型的依赖性越强,系统失效导致业务中断的风险会越大。其他的问题包括报价传递给交易员的技术延迟或延误问题,安全问题和超前交易(Front Running),以及全部系统失效导致市场崩盘的可能性。开发和维护算法的成本还是相对较高,对市场新入者而言尤其如此,这是由于算法交易对系统的稳定性、网络带宽和速度的要求比常规的下单指令执行要高很多。没有自行开发算法交易的公司不得不从竞争对手手中购买。高盛公司在算法交易上花了数千万美金,他们技术部门的人员比交易部门还要多……市场的性质已经发生了巨大的改变。如今金融市场的信息已被诸如路透、道琼斯、彭博、汤姆逊金融等公司格式化,通过算法的解读来形成交易。计算机被用来生产消息,譬如公司公布盈利结果或公布经济统计数据,这些消息几乎在瞬间同步直接传输给其它计算机,由它们根据消息进行交易。交易算法并不仅仅是根据简单的消息进行交易,它还能翻译更难理解的消息。一些公司还试图对消息自动“设置表情”(以表示该消息是好是坏),这样的话自动交易就可以直接根据消息进行了。“将消息从人类语言翻译到机器语言这一进程实在很有意义,”路透算法交易全球业务经理克里斯蒂.苏塔尼说,“我们越来越多的顾客发现了利用消息赚钱的途径”。消息报道的速度对算法交易的重要性不言而喻,在一例广告宣传中(2008年3月1日的《华尔街日报》W15版面刊登),道琼斯声称自己在报道英格兰银行降息时比其他新闻媒体快了2秒钟。2007年7月,早已自行开发算法交易的花旗集团,花了6.8亿美元购买了自动化交易平台,它原来属于一家每天交易约2亿股(占美国市场交易量的6%)股票的具有19年历史的公司。在这以前花旗集团还购买过Lava交易与OnTrade有限公司。

3. 算法交易的问题进展

对于算法交易,一般而言有这么几大类问题
1. 什么是算法交易?
算法交易又称自动交易,指的是通过使用计算机程序来发出交易指令的方法
2. 为什么要用算法交易?
一般而言,当投资者需要进行大额交易时,即买入或卖出大量股票时,需要用到算法交易,其会将大单拆分成N个小单,报单委托完成交易任务
3. 算法交易有什么作用?
算法交易的作用就是为了降低交易成本,通过拆单的方式,使得成交价靠近市场均价,以此完成交易计划
4. 怎么用算法交易?
目前华创证券和同花顺联合推出了智能算法交易平台,你可以关注“同花顺智能交易”微信公众号,预约申请试用~
 
希望能帮助到你

算法交易的问题进展

4. 算法交易的中国发展

在中国,对算法交易的研究起步很晚,深圳国泰安信息技术有限公司在国内算法交易的推广上走在前列,已经率先推出了完全自主知识产权的算法交易系统1.0版,该系统填补了国内算法交易的空白。“国泰安算法交易系统”是采用国际最主流的交易策略进行智能化下单交易的专业投资工具,帮助用户实现减少市场冲击、降低交易成本、增加投资收益,实现套利的目的。该系统采用策略主要有“VWAP”、“VP”、“TWAP”、“Schedule”、“MOC”、“Sniper”策略。据统计,在目前国际市场上,通常采用的策略主要有6-8种,而采用:“VWAP”、“TWAP”、“VP”三种策略进行交易的成交量约占算法交易总成交量的60%。同时开发了“MOC”、“Sniper”等高级策略,满足了目前绝大多数金融机构限价下单的需求。国泰安算法交易系统的算法策略考虑了国内证券交易的实际规则,经过对大量历史高频数据的检验分析,完全适合国内证券交易市场;同时支持用户灵活配置策略参数,动态监控算法执行情况,能够有效的控制交易风险;而且操作简单,能够让客户非常方便地体验到算法策略带来的便利和收益。● 规则优化处理根据国内证券交易的实际规则,经过对大量历史高频数据的检验分析,对算法策略进行修正与完善,使“国泰安算法交易系统”真正适合国内证券交易市场。● 灵活策略配置用户可根据交易习惯、市场变化,选择不同算法,设置参与度、缓急度、交易时点等参数,灵活调整交易策略。● 完整决策结构该系统决策结构完整,提供交易前、中、后的交易服务。交易前:收集历史交易数据,分析交易时间、价格、数量,制定多种交易策略。交易中:系统自动执行交易策略;用户也可实时监控交易,及时处理突发事件,如不满意交易结果,也可手动停止。交易后:系统提供详细的交易报告,供用户盘后分析,可据此优化算法策略,增加投资回报。● 动态交易及风险监控运用动态图形监控画面,用户可以轻松监控股票组合、个股的交易执行和风险等情况。而且可以设定各种预警指标和预警动作,有效地控制交易风险。● 操作简单方便学习国际经验化繁为简,任何用户都可以通过简单的操作,直接体验到算法策略带来的便利和收益。

5. 算法交易的带来效应

算法交易的兴起对整个金融市场带来了深刻的影响与变化。百分位报价改革引起的交易规模缩小可能促进了算法交易的发展,而算法交易则进一步缩小了交易规模。曾经由人来担任的交易员工作正在被电脑所取代。数以毫秒计的电脑连接速度,变得更为重要。诸如纳斯达克这样自动化程度较高的市场已经从诸如纽约证券交易所这样自动化程度较低的市场获取了更多的市场份额。电子化交易的经济规模效应为降低佣金和交易费用作出贡献,也为金融交易所的国际化兼并整合作出了贡献。交易所之间的竞争也愈加激烈,交易处理速度也越来越快。以伦敦证券交易所为例,它在2007年6月启动了一个叫TradElect的新系统,该系统平均每10毫秒就能完成从下单到确认的整个过程,并且能够每秒处理3000个指令。2005年金融行业用于电脑和软件上花费达到了264亿美元。经纪公司发现越来越难监控客户的持仓风险,特别是对冲基金这样的客户。

算法交易的带来效应

6. 算法交易的介绍

算法交易,也称为自动交易,黑盒交易,是利用电子平台,输入涉及算法的交易指令,以执行预先设定好的交易策略。算法中包含许多变量,包括时间,价格,交易量,或者在许多情况下,由“机器人”发起指令,而无需人工干预。算法交易广泛应用于投资银行,养老基金,共同基金,以及其他买方机构投资者,以把大额交易分割为许多小额交易来应付市场风险和冲击。卖方交易员,例如做市商和一些对冲基金,为市场提供流动性,自动生成和执行指令。

7. 算法交易策略的五个常见的算法策略

算法交易策略  
  
 从字面上看,有成千上万种潜在的  算法交易策略  ,以下是几种最常见的快速入门策略:
  
 趋势跟随算法:通过确定明显的订单流向确定您的优势。此优势可能超过几个月,也可能超过几分钟。该策略成功的关键是确定运行时间。挑一个点进入。时间范围越短,您交易的频率就越高,因为趋势会更快地变化并且您会收到更多的信号。
  
 
  
                                          
 
  
  
 基于动量的算法策略:动量算法希望期货合约在高交易量上迅速向一个方向移动。该边缘试图在停顿时快速进入,获得动能,然后在下一个停顿时退出。这种算法不会赢得大赢家。有利的一面是,它也不应该有大输家。订单流方向上的动量策略通常被认为是明智的交易。
  
 反趋势算法:该策略通常确定动量的饱和点,并“淡化”此举,而不是与动量进行交易。反趋势交易是一种特殊的分配资本形式,并非为胆小者而设。由于算法的原因,最后一条特别正确!在一段时间内,价格走势具有良好的前后波动性。如果您处于亏损交易中,则很有可能“以亏损仓位进行交易”。算法的变化很大。在当今的算法驱动世界中,将同时触发多个算法程序,并且价格在一个方向上爆炸运行。不要为反潮流的新手而有所缓和。
  
 回归均值算法:想象一条橡皮筋通常会扩展到“ 10”。当到达该距离时,它会向后拉,或恢复为正常距离。这是回归到平均算法交易。当期货合约超出预期范围时,您的算法将剖析数据并下订单。这项交易的目标是在一个极端的价格点准时进入,以预期获利逆转。
  
 剥头皮算法策略:某些市场提供跟踪大型买卖双方的机会。这里的策略是“Capture propagation”。这意味着在Bid上买入,然后在要约上卖出,赚了几tick。多年来,这种算法一直是许多day tradetr/floor trader的头等大事。价差收窄和计算机速度更快,这对手动交易者造成了挑战。一扇门关闭,一扇门打开,为精明的算法开发商和交易员提供了扩展机会。
  
 HFT | 高频交易算法:这是获得所有宣传的算法。特权量子向导的感知货币机器。HFT程序会在一毫秒内执行,并且需要在交换机附近安装所谓的“共置”服务器。执行速度对于成功至关重要。

算法交易策略的五个常见的算法策略